What Time Do Stranger Things Drop: The first episode of Season 4, Part 1 of “Stranger Things,” will soon arrive. The Netflix series’ fourth season is its longest one yet, with each episode lasting more than 60 minutes (the finale itself will be more than two hours long). When the […]
What Time Do Stranger Things Drop
1 post